One of the greatest creative pairings on FANTASTIC FOUR since Stan Lee and Jack Kirby, Mark Waid and Mike Wieringo brought Marvel's First Family into a golden era - and straight into one of their most monumental showdowns with the greatest foe, Doctor Doom!
The Fantastic Four’s arch-nemesis, Doctor Doom, has leveled up by doing the unthinkable! But what great sacrifice did Doom make to gain his frightful power — and his terrifying new armor? Victor strikes at the very heart of Marvel’s First Family by targeting the children of Reed and Sue Richards. To save Franklin and Valeria from their fates, the FF must fight harder than ever before — and Mister Fantastic, ever the scientist, must force himself to learn and believe in magic! Even if they survive this deadly encounter, the emotional scars left will not be gone anytime soon — so what can the Thing do to help?
COLLECTING: Fantastic Four (1998) 67-70, 500-502
